Find and use the hidden switch
On some washing machines, there is a “hidden switch” that you must turn on to get the dirty water to drain.
This part is usually located in the lower right corner of the washing machine, with a small cover above it. Press lightly so that the top cover opens. This is where the machine’s sediment filter is located.
Before opening the sediment filter cover, place a cloth underneath to prevent residual dirty water from leaking out and dirtying the floor. Remove the filter tube by gently twisting it and then pulling it out.
